.common_paper__xZA_F{width:100%;max-width:500px;padding:48px 48px 32px;display:flex;flex-direction:column;gap:16px;border-radius:0;min-width:500px;margin:0 auto}@media(max-width:48em){.common_paper__xZA_F{padding:32px 16px 16px;min-width:auto}}.common_successPaper__UQotL{padding:48px}@media(max-width:48em){.common_successPaper__UQotL{padding:32px}}.common_buttonPrimary__hV2nu{background-color:var(--primary)}.common_buttonSecondary__sA94G{background-color:var(--primary-light)}.common_buttonWhite__6XbrV{background-color:var(--mantine-color-white);color:var(--primary)}.common_loaderWhite__sDANv:after{border-color:var(--mantine-color-white) var(--mantine-color-white) var(--mantine-color-white) rgba(0,0,0,0)}.common_loaderBlue__gJuXR:after{border-color:var(--primary) var(--primary) var(--primary) rgba(0,0,0,0)}.common_textButton__hyTuC{color:var(--primary-light);font-size:14px;line-height:20px;display:inline}.common_primary__q40VR{color:var(--primary)}.common_boxWithBg__W92e0{flex:1;width:100%;background-image:url(https://impronta-assets-public.s3.eu-central-1.amazonaws.com/roche/convention-2026/roche-header.png);background-size:cover;background-position:top;background-repeat:no-repeat}@supports(aspect-ratio:16/12){.common_boxWithBg__W92e0{aspect-ratio:16/7}}@media(max-width:900px){.common_boxWithBg__W92e0{background-image:url(/bg-mobile.png);background-position:left 50% top 10%}@supports(aspect-ratio:16/12){.common_boxWithBg__W92e0{aspect-ratio:16/12}}}@media(max-width:48em){.Layout_app__s1Xmg{height:auto;min-height:100vh}}.Layout_inner__Bpw_X{height:100%;display:flex;align-items:center;justify-content:space-between;margin:0 auto}.Layout_main__Ybyix{display:flex;flex-direction:column;justify-content:center;height:auto;background-image:url(https://impronta-assets-public.s3.eu-central-1.amazonaws.com/roche/convention-2026/roche-header.png);background-size:cover;background-position:top;background-repeat:no-repeat}@media(max-width:48em){.Layout_main__Ybyix{background-image:url(/bg-mobile.png);background-position:left 50% top 10%;background-image:none}}.Layout_footer__mDCke{position:static;border-top:1px solid #dbd6d1}@media(max-width:48em){.Layout_hide__9FC5r{display:none}}@media(min-width:768px){.Layout_mobileMain__V4nwS{height:860px;height:90vh;min-height:700px}}.LoginForm_inner___Qm_u{flex-wrap:wrap;max-width:600px;width:100%;gap:16px;align-items:flex-end}@media(max-width:48em){.LoginForm_inner___Qm_u{flex-direction:column;align-items:center;gap:24px}}.LoginForm_inputWrapper__MDGI4{flex:1}@media(max-width:48em){.LoginForm_inputWrapper__MDGI4{width:100%;flex:initial}}.LoginForm_buttonWrapper__Ib4Y4{min-width:200px}@media(max-width:48em){.LoginForm_buttonWrapper__Ib4Y4{width:100%;min-width:auto}}.LogisticForm_stepperPaper__K0IEB{width:100%;max-width:500px;position:relative;flex:1;display:flex;flex-direction:column;overflow:hidden;margin:86px auto 40px}@media(max-width:48em){.LogisticForm_stepperPaper__K0IEB{max-width:none;border-radius:0;overflow:initial;min-height:100vh;margin:0}}.LogisticForm_header__pn_gI{justify-content:space-between;align-items:center;gap:8px;width:100%;padding:16px 32px}@media(max-width:48em){.LogisticForm_header__pn_gI{padding:16px;position:fixed;top:0;left:0;width:100%;background-color:#fff;z-index:10}}.LogisticForm_indicator__zGUPh{flex:1;height:6px;border-radius:3px;background-color:var(--gray-super-light);position:relative;overflow:hidden}.LogisticForm_indicator__zGUPh:after{content:"";display:block;height:100%;width:0;background-color:var(--primary)}.LogisticForm_halfFull__wVhze:after{width:50%}.LogisticForm_full___pP6B:after{width:100%}.LogisticForm_body__Cq_kq{flex:1;overflow:hidden}@media(max-width:48em){.LogisticForm_body__Cq_kq{padding-top:72px;flex:initial;overflow:initial}}.LogisticForm_inner__IoIzE{height:100%;display:flex;flex-direction:column;padding:0 32px 16px;gap:40px;overflow:auto}@media(max-width:48em){.LogisticForm_inner__IoIzE{padding:0 16px 16px;overflow:initial}}.LogisticForm_buttons__b3lmS{flex:1}.LogisticForm_confirmModal__jIUFC{width:100%;max-width:500px;min-width:500px;padding:32px 16px 16px}@media(max-width:48em){.LogisticForm_confirmModal__jIUFC{min-width:auto}}.LogisticForm_departureCityField__ksFnA{margin:0;padding:.8rem 1rem;border:1px solid #dbd6d1}.style_cardTripInfoReadonly__IriSm{padding:1rem;border:1px solid #dbd6d1}.style_cardTripInfoHead__Qq76w{font-weight:700;font-size:1.5rem;font-weight:300;color:#0b41cd;margin:0}.style_cardTripInfoBody__o71gY{display:flex;justify-content:space-between;margin-top:1rem;gap:1rem}.style_cardTripInfoBody__o71gY div{flex-basis:50%}.style_cardTripInfoBody__o71gY div div+div{margin-top:.8rem}.style_cardInput__EuMhQ{display:flex;border:none;background:none;padding:0}.style_cardInput__EuMhQ input{appearance:none;width:0;height:0;overflow:hidden;margin:0}.style_cardInput__EuMhQ label{margin:0;flex:1;border:1px solid #dbd6d1;display:flex;flex-direction:column;padding:1rem;cursor:pointer}.style_cardInput__EuMhQ input:checked+label{border-color:#0b41cd;background-color:rgba(11,66,205,.05)}.style_cardInputIndicator__Tk6NG{display:inline-flex;justify-content:center;align-items:center;width:1.25rem;height:1.25rem;border-radius:100%;border:1px solid #dbd6d1}.style_cardInputIndicator__Tk6NG:before{width:.5rem;height:.5rem;border-radius:100%;background-color:#fff}.style_cardInputIndicatorChecked__7sRNs{background-color:#0b41cd}.style_cardInputIndicatorChecked__7sRNs:before{content:""}